Jean Paul Debono is succeeding Mark Bamber as Non-Executive Director at Stivala Group Finance, with effect from 21st April 2022.

Mr Bamber tendered his resignation from the office of Non-Executive Director, Legal and Judicial Representative of the Company, and from being a Member of the Audit Committee on that same day.

Stivala Group Finance thanked Mr Bamber for his service and contribution to the company.

A Certified Public Accountant and Practicing Auditor, Mr Debono has also been appointed as a Member of Stivala Group Finance’s Audit Committee.

The Non-Executive Director is specialised in accounting, taxation, and financial reporting and has extensive experience in servicing local and international clients across a wide range of industry sectors.

“Mr Debono has an all-round grasp and knowledge of commercial affairs in Malta and is routinely involved in effective business decision-making, advising on corporate structure, corporate finance, and on the preparation of business plans,” the company said.

Before founding Debono & Associates, a multi-disciplinary firm offering audit, accounting, tax, and advisory services, Mr Debono worked with various medium-sized firms servicing both domestic and international clients.
